The Pak® cartridges are often referred to as lenticular filter modules. They consist of depth filter media sheets comprised of cellulose fibers, varying filter aids (such as Diatomaceous Earth), or activated carbon. These sheets are sealed together to form a stack of “cells” that resemble double convex lenses, creating a high surface area within a compact footprint [ertelalsop.com](https://ertelalsop.com/lenticular-pak-cartridges/).

How Lenticular Filtration Works

Unlike surface filtration, which catches particles only on the top layer, depth filtration traps particulates throughout the thickness of the media matrix. The ErtelAlsop Pak® utilizes a tortuous path for the liquid, ensuring high retention efficiency and the ability to hold a significant amount of solids before needing replacement.

The modules are constructed by creating individual cells from pairs of die-cut media sheets. The edges are sealed—often using a patented polypropylene process—to prevent bypass. These cells are then stacked on a central core. This design directs liquid flow from the outside of the cartridge, through the media, and into the central core, ensuring that all fluid is treated effectively [ertelalsop.com](https://ertelalsop.com/lenticular-pak-cartridges/).

Key Features and Benefits

  • Enclosed System: Unlike plate and frame filters, lenticular modules operate inside a sealed housing. This prevents leakage, reduces exposure to the product, and creates a cleaner, safer work environment.
  • High Solids Loading: The depth media structure allows for substantial contaminant holding capacity, leading to longer service life and reduced downtime.
  • Scalability: With sizes available in 12-inch and 16-inch diameters and various cell counts (5 to 18 cells), systems can be scaled from pilot lab testing to full production [ertelalsop.com](https://ertelalsop.com/lenticular-pak-cartridges/).
  • Versatile Configurations: Modules are available with Flat Gasket or Double O-Ring end caps to fit a wide variety of housings options.

Available Media Formulations

The versatility of the Pak® cartridge lies in the wide range of available media grades:

  • MicroMedia®: Incorporates cellulose not only with filter aids but also resin, providing excellent wet strength and zeta potential for capturing ultra-fine particles and haze. Ideal for pharmaceutical and botanical extracts [store.clearsolutionscorp.com](https://store.clearsolutionscorp.com/products/pak-lenticular-filter).
  • AlphaMedia®: A pure cellulose media generally used for clarifying applications where no filter aids are required.
  • MicroClear®: Contain activated carbon for adsorption applications, such as color or odor removal, without the mess of handling loose carbon powder [ertelalsop.com](https://ertelalsop.com/lenticular-pak-cartridges/).

Common Applications

Due to their enclosed design and range of media grades, ErtelAlsop Pak® cartridges are utilized in diverse sectors:

  • Botanical Extracts: Removal of waxes and lipids using Diatomaceous Earth (DE) impregnated media [store.clearsolutionscorp.com](https://store.clearsolutionscorp.com/products/pak-lenticular-filter).
  • Food & Beverage: Polishing filtration for distilled spirits, syrups, and beverages to ensure clarity and stability.
  • Pharmaceuticals: Clarification of cell cultures and removal of precipitates in API production.
  • Cosmetics: Filtration of fragrances, essential oils, and lotions.
  • Chemicals: Removal of carbon fines or catalyst recovery.
